UF_WELD_ask_body_id (view source)
 
Defined in: uf_weld.h
 
Overview
Gets all body tags of welds in a weld feature set.

Environment
Internal and External

See Also
UF_WELD_locate_welds2

History
Original release was in V16.0.1
 
Required License(s)
gateway

 
int UF_WELD_ask_body_id
(
tag_t feature_set_tag,
tag_p_t * body_id,
int * num_objects
)
tag_tfeature_set_tagInputFeature set tag of the weld
tag_p_t *body_idOutput to UF_*free*Array of body tags of welds.
This must be freed by calling UF_free.
int *num_objectsOutputNumber of welds in the weld feature set.

UF_WELD_ask_groove_or_edge_guide (view source)
 
Defined in: uf_weld.h
 
Overview
Given a Groove or Edge weld tag, this function returns the guide curves for
the weld. For all other types of welds refer to UF_WELD_ask_guide_curves.

Environment
Internal and External.

See Also
UF_WELD_ask_guide_curves

History
Originally released in v16.0.1
 
Required License(s)
gateway

 
int UF_WELD_ask_groove_or_edge_guide
(
tag_t weld_feat_tag,
uf_list_p_t * guide_crv_cnt,
uf_list_p_t * guide_curves
)
tag_tweld_feat_tagInputtag of the weld feature, can be only
Groove or Edge weld feature
uf_list_p_t *guide_crv_cntOutput to UF_*free*tags of the first set of guide strings
use UF_MODL_delete_list to free
uf_list_p_t *guide_curvesOutput to UF_*free*tags of the second set of guide strings
use UF_MODL_delete_list to free

 


 
UF_WELD_ask_guide_curves (view source)
 
Defined in: uf_weld.h
 
Overview
Given the feature set tag, this function returns the guide curves for all
weld types except Groove and Edge welds. Note that guide curves are not
returned if the input tag is a Plug or Slot weld.

Environment
Internal and External.

See Also
UF_WELD_ask_groove_or_edge_guide

History
Originally released in v16.0.1
 
Required License(s)
gateway

 
int UF_WELD_ask_guide_curves
(
tag_t weld_feat_tag,
int * guide_crv_cnt,
tag_t * * guide_curves
)
tag_tweld_feat_tagInputtag of the weld feature, can be either
Fillet, Arc Spot, Resistance Spot,
Resistance Seam, Bead, Tape,
Dollop or Clinch
int *guide_crv_cntOutputNumber of guide curves
tag_t * *guide_curvesOutput to UF_*free*tag of guide curves

UF_WELD_ask_seam_weld_info (view source)
 
Defined in: uf_weld.h
 
Overview
Given the feature set tag, this function returns the tags of the seams in the
feature set and the faces involved in the seam. Please note that this function
works for seam weld and bead.

Environment
Internal and External.

History
Originally released in v16.0.1
 
Required License(s)
gateway

 
int UF_WELD_ask_seam_weld_info
(
tag_t seam_feature_set,
int * seam_count,
tag_p_t * seam_id,
int * num_sets,
int * * n_faces_in_each_set,
tag_p_t * * set_of_faces
)
tag_tseam_feature_setInputtag of the seam feature set
int *seam_countOutputcount of the seams in the feature set
tag_p_t *seam_idOutput to UF_*free*tags of the seams in the feature set. Use
UF_free to free this variable.
int *num_setsOutputnumber of sets of faces involved in the
weld
int * *n_faces_in_each_setOutput to UF_*free*number of faces in each set. Must free using
UF_free_string_array
tag_p_t * *set_of_facesOutput to UF_*free*tags of the faces involved in the weld.
Use UF_free_string_array to free the array

UF_WELD_locate_welds2 (view source)
 
Defined in: uf_weld.h
 
Overview
To fetch an array of all weld objects in the specified assembly.
Optionally, filter the weld objects by weld type.
The weld_array must be freed using UF_free.
This replaces UF_WELD_locate_welds, which only returns legacy welds.

Environment
Internal and External

History
Originally released in NX 5.0
 
Required License(s)
gateway

 
int UF_WELD_locate_welds2
(
tag_t work_part,
UF_WELD_feature_types_array types_array,
int * count,
tag_p_t * weld_array
)
tag_twork_partInputThe specified assembly to query
UF_WELD_feature_types_arraytypes_arrayInputAn array of logicals to indicate which
weld types to return. Use
UF_WELD_INIT_TYPES_ARRAY(types_array,false)
to initialize all to off. Use
UF_WELD_INIT_TYPES_ARRAY(types_array,true)
to get all weld types. To get a specific
weld feature, use UF_WELD_feature_types_e
to turn on a specific weld feature.
int *countOutputPointer to the number of weld object which
answer the query. This may be 0.

This storage is not allocated by the
function. Pass in a valid integer location

If the count is not desired, pass in a NULL
instead of a pointer
tag_p_t *weld_arrayOutput to UF_*free*The pointer in which to return the array
containing the tags of the found
weld_objects.

If NULL is passed in instead of a pointer,
then the array is not returned.
Such an option might be used to simply
obtain a count of the objects.

If the pointer is returned as non_NULL,
then the array must be freed by UF_free
